dc.description.abstract Seismic studies conducted using 18 profiles with seismoacoustic radio buoys and airguns on the shelf and continental slope of East Kamchatka and at the Obruchev Rise made it possible to determine velocities in the sedimentary layer and acoustic basement. Velocity in the coastal shelf increases with depth together with the gradient of 1.8—2.0 s-1 and in the off-shelf with the gradient of 1.4—1.5 s-1. Velocities near the bottom of the coastal shelf are 2,25— 3.5 km/s. Velocity variations in the continental slope sediments can be described by equation v= 1.75+0.51 Z. Variations at the Obruchev Rise and in the regions adjacent to the deep sea basin can be described by equation v= 1.55+0.74 Z. Z is the depth beneath the bottom in km. The gradient is measured in (s-1), velocity in (km/s).
